Motru is a town in Gorj County in Romania .

Geographical location

Motru is located on a river of the same name in the west of Little Wallachia . The district capital Târgu Jiu is about 35 km northeast.

history

Motru was created by administrative decision in 1966 on the territory of the then municipality Ploştina , which together with seven other villages became part of the new city. The reason for the decision to found a city was the development of several hard coal deposits.

The region has been inhabited since the time of the Roman Empire at the latest ; In 1964 some silver coins from the time of Emperor Septimius Severus (193-211) were found in the district of Leurda . The oldest documented settlement on the territory of today's city is Ploştina (mentioned in a document in 1385).

In the villages incorporated today, some free farmers lived, others were subject to the monastery in Tismana .

In 2000 Motru was named a municipality ( Municipiul ) - that is, a more important city.

The most important industry in the city is mining; in addition, agriculture and animal husbandry play an important role, especially in the incorporated villages.

population

At the 2002 census there were 22,967 people in the city, including 22,718 Romanians , 91 Hungarians , 129 Roma and 15 Germans.

traffic

Motru has a rail connection via a line leading from Strehaia , which was put into operation in 1962. Local trains run to Craiova several times a day . There are also bus connections to the district capital Târgu Jiu . Motru is on the National Road Drum național 67 from Drobeta Turnu Severin to Râmnicu Vâlcea .
